headband
Showing 10–18 of 30 results
-
YELLOW VELVET HEADBAND
£24.00 -
PADDED BLACK VELVET HEADBAND
£38.00 -
SASHA HEADBAND
£42.00 -
CHRISTIE HEADBAND
£62.00 -
AZURE BLUE RUCHED HEADBAND
£24.00 -
PINK VELVET HEADBAND
£24.00
Showing 10–18 of 30 results